Transaction 5624b61c3414848a0863658707d1cc2b95aeb8d7e7aa2672dfd89d10d7f17504

1 Input
2 Outputs
  • 5624b61c3414848a0863658707d1cc2b95aeb8d7e7aa2672dfd89d10d7f17504:0
  • value  6270
    address  1JxMpbKFjpK6TYYiiYjGAMQJgasWz9Z5Dh
  • 5624b61c3414848a0863658707d1cc2b95aeb8d7e7aa2672dfd89d10d7f17504:1
  • value  509970000
    address  13xPhoi4i17A1y3HgyWjdThznWuD2Semdk